The Carnivore diet naturally sets the stage for successful fasting. By eliminating carbohydrates, the body shifts from burning glucose to primarily burning fat for fuel. This metabolic state, known as ketosis, reduces hunger pangs and stabilizes blood sugar, making longer periods without food much more manageable and comfortable. When you're fat-adapted, your body has a consistent, efficient fuel source, leading to fewer energy crashes often associated with conventional diets.
1. Prioritize Nutrient-Dense Foods During Eating Windows: Before embarking on a fast, ensure your last meal is rich in healthy fats and proteins. Think fatty cuts of meat like ribeye, lamb, or even organ meats. These provide sustained energy and satiety, preparing your body for the fasting period. The goal is to feel truly nourished and satisfied, not just full.
2. Hydration is Paramount: During a fast, adequate hydration is more crucial than ever. Water helps with satiety, electrolyte balance, and overall bodily functions. While plain water is excellent, consider supplementing with electrolytes. Sodium, potassium, and magnesium are vital and can be depleted during fasting. A pinch of quality sea salt in water can make a significant difference in preventing headaches and fatigue.
3. Start Slowly and Listen to Your Body: There's no need to jump straight into extended fasts. Begin with intermittent fasting, such as a 16:8 protocol (fasting for 16 hours, eating within an 8-hour window). Once comfortable, you might explore 18:6, 20:4, or even one meal a day (OMAD). The key is gradual adaptation. Pay close attention to how your body feels; genuine hunger, not just habit, should be your guide.
4. Manage Your Mindset: Often, the biggest hurdle in fasting is mental rather than physical. Distinguish between true hunger and psychological cravings or boredom. Engage in activities that distract and fulfill you during fasting periods. Reading, light exercise, work, or hobbies can be excellent ways to shift focus away from food. Remember your "why"—the health benefits you're seeking.
5. Embrace Electrolyte Support: As mentioned, electrolytes are critical. While many people turn to electrolyte drinks, check their ingredients carefully for sugars or artificial sweeteners. For a clean Carnivore approach, simply adding unrefined salt to water, or consuming electrolyte supplements free from unwanted additives, can be incredibly beneficial. Signs of electrolyte imbalance include headaches, muscle cramps, and fatigue.
6. Avoid Overeating During Eating Windows: While it's important to eat until satisfied, avoid the temptation to overcompensate for the fasting period. Focus on mindful eating, savoring your nutrient-dense animal foods. This helps maintain the metabolic benefits achieved during your fast and prevents digestive discomfort.
